Cllrs To Approve Consultation On Major Leeds Regeneration Scheme

Councillors are set to approve a three-month consultation on a major regeneration scheme in Leeds.

The local authority will discuss proceeding with a public consultation on the redevelopment of the South Bank area at a meeting on Wednesday, 27 July.

As one of the largest developments of its kind in Europe, features include creating 4,000 new homes, new infrastructure, 35,000 jobs and a leading European destination for living, working and leisure.

A key element of the consultation will focus on opportunities provided by the redevelopment of Leeds Station to integrate high-speed HS2 and Northern Powerhouse (HS3) rail services with the existing transport network.

Planning permissions have already been granted for 1,000 new homes while the area will also feature a new £125m Climate Innovation District of eco-friendly housing.

Council Leader Judith Blake said: "The hugely exciting potential around South Bank Leeds means it is an incredible opportunity to regenerate and transform the area into a vibrant, modern and attractive place to live, learn, work and visit. We have already seen some success in the area with businesses of all shapes and sizes heading there. Further development will help drive job creation for local people for many years to come and will be a massive boost to the city and wider regional economy.

"All of those benefits only happen, however, if we get the plans right and that is why it is vital we get the views from as many people as possible to find out what they think. Integrating and linking the South Bank fully with surrounding communities and the wider city is essential, along with the connections to the transport network and maximising the redeveloped Leeds Station."
